Output 3bbbb93f4515a6dd5c65dfbc18152a4d149fe783afa8d001bf62d93d2abd54cf:132

value
70606
script pubkey
OP_0 OP_PUSHBYTES_20 bd7a5fd6313783ee8bcad920c1603ea0267ddb18
address
bc1qh4a9l433x7p7az72mysvzcp75qn8mkcce4p2te
transaction
3bbbb93f4515a6dd5c65dfbc18152a4d149fe783afa8d001bf62d93d2abd54cf
confirmations
33438
spent
true